My Buying Guides on Mini Chopper Motorcycle 50cc

Why I Consider a 50cc Mini Chopper

When I look for a mini chopper motorcycle 50cc, I focus on the fun factor first. I like that it gives me the classic chopper style in a smaller, easier-to-handle package. For short rides, beginner use, or casual cruising, I find a 50cc model appealing because it is usually lighter, more affordable, and simpler to manage than larger bikes.

Who I Think It Is Best For

In my opinion, a 50cc mini chopper is best for:

  • New riders who want a low-power bike
  • Teens or smaller riders, where allowed by local laws
  • Casual riders who want a stylish mini motorcycle
  • People looking for a budget-friendly entry into motorcycling

I always remind myself to check local age, licensing, and registration rules before buying.

What I Look for in Engine Performance

For me, the engine is one of the most important parts. A 50cc engine should be smooth, reliable, and easy to start. I pay attention to:

  • Engine type: 2-stroke or 4-stroke
  • Starting system: electric start, kick start, or both
  • Top speed: enough for my intended use
  • Fuel efficiency: helpful for saving money
  • Cooling system: air-cooled models are often simpler

I usually prefer a 4-stroke engine if I want quieter operation and easier maintenance.

How I Judge Build Quality

When I inspect a mini chopper, I look closely at the frame, welds, and overall finish. A sturdy steel frame gives me more confidence. I also check:

  • Paint quality and rust resistance
  • Seat comfort
  • Handlebar fit and control placement
  • Tire quality and wheel strength
  • Brake responsiveness

If the bike feels flimsy, I usually move on.

Comfort and Ride Feel Matter to Me

Even on a small bike, I want to feel comfortable. I look at seat height, seat padding, and riding posture. Since mini choppers often have a low, stretched-out design, I make sure the riding position feels natural and not too cramped. I also consider whether the suspension can handle bumps without making the ride harsh.

Safety Features I Never Ignore

I always put safety first. Before buying, I check for:

  • Reliable front and rear brakes
  • Strong tires with good grip
  • Working lights and reflectors
  • A stable frame and low center of gravity
  • Easy-to-reach controls

I also think about wearing proper gear every time I ride, including a helmet, gloves, and protective clothing.

Maintenance and Parts Availability

I prefer a mini chopper that is easy to maintain. I look for models with parts that are easy to find, because that saves me time and stress later. I also consider:

  • How often oil changes are needed
  • Whether the chain or belt is easy to adjust
  • Availability of spark plugs, tires, and brake parts
  • How simple the engine is to service

A bike with widely available parts usually feels like a smarter buy to me.

Price and Value for Money

When I compare prices, I do not just look for the cheapest option. I ask myself whether the bike gives me good value. A slightly higher price can be worth it if the build quality, reliability, and support are better. I also factor in:

  • Shipping or assembly costs
  • Replacement parts
  • Registration and insurance, if required
  • Long-term maintenance expenses

What I Check Before Buying Online

If I buy online, I carefully read the product description and customer reviews. I make sure the listing includes:

  • Engine specifications
  • Dimensions and weight
  • Assembly requirements
  • Warranty details
  • Return policy

I also look for clear photos and honest reviews from real buyers.

My Final Buying Advice

If I were choosing a mini chopper motorcycle 50cc, I would focus on safety, comfort, engine reliability, and parts availability before anything else. I would not rush the decision. For me, the best mini chopper is the one that matches my riding needs, feels solid, and offers good long-term value.
